json: Add operator[] to QJsonDocument for implicit object and array access

Makes it easier to pull out data from a document when the structure is
known up front, while still supporting default values if the structure
does not match the expectation, eg:

 int age = QJsonDocument::fromJson(ba)["users"][0]["age"].toInt(-1);

/*!
Returns a QJsonValue representing the value for the key \a key.
Equivalent to calling object().value(key).
The returned QJsonValue is QJsonValue::Undefined if the key does not exist,
or if isObject() is false.
\since 5.10
\sa QJsonValue, QJsonValue::isUndefined(), QJsonObject
*/
const QJsonValue QJsonDocument::operator[](const QString &key) const
{
if (!isObject())
return QJsonValue(QJsonValue::Undefined);
return object().value(key);
}
/*!
\overload
\since 5.10
*/
const QJsonValue QJsonDocument::operator[](QLatin1String key) const
{
if (!isObject())
return QJsonValue(QJsonValue::Undefined);
return object().value(key);
}
/*!
Returns a QJsonValue representing the value for index \a i.
Equivalent to calling array().at(i).
The returned QJsonValue is QJsonValue::Undefined, if \a i is out of bounds,
or if isArray() is false.
\since 5.10
\sa QJsonValue, QJsonValue::isUndefined(), QJsonArray
*/
const QJsonValue QJsonDocument::operator[](int i) const
{
if (!isArray())
return QJsonValue(QJsonValue::Undefined);
return array().at(i);
}

void tst_QtJson::implicitDocumentType()
{
QJsonDocument emptyDocument;
QCOMPARE(emptyDocument["asObject"], QJsonValue(QJsonValue::Undefined));
QCOMPARE(emptyDocument[123], QJsonValue(QJsonValue::Undefined));
QJsonDocument objectDocument(QJsonObject{{"value", 42}});
QCOMPARE(objectDocument["value"].toInt(), 42);
QCOMPARE(objectDocument["missingValue"], QJsonValue(QJsonValue::Undefined));
QCOMPARE(objectDocument[123], QJsonValue(QJsonValue::Undefined));
QCOMPARE(objectDocument["missingValue"].toInt(123), 123);
QJsonDocument arrayDocument(QJsonArray{665, 666, 667});
QCOMPARE(arrayDocument[1].toInt(), 666);
QCOMPARE(arrayDocument[-1], QJsonValue(QJsonValue::Undefined));
QCOMPARE(arrayDocument["asObject"], QJsonValue(QJsonValue::Undefined));
QCOMPARE(arrayDocument[-1].toInt(123), 123);
}
